What Are Wooden Pallets?
Wooden pallets are flat structures made of wood, developed to support products in a steady way during storage or transport. They can be found in different sizes and designs, with the most common being the standard Euro Pallet and the North American Grocery Pallet. Below is a table comparing these 2 popular pallet sizes:

There are many factors to think about purchasing second-hand wooden pallets:
Environmental Impact: Using pre-owned pallets helps in reducing waste, as it prevents an otherwise functional item from ending up in landfills. This is a crucial step in promoting a circular economy where products are kept in use for longer.
Cost-Effective: New pallets can be expensive, particularly for businesses with high logistical requirements. Second-hand pallets are generally more affordable, assisting to keep total expenses low.
Schedule: Many services have surplus pallets they no longer require, making them easily offered for purchase. This high availability can make it easier to source products wholesale.
Adaptability: Wooden pallets can be used in a variety of applications, from shipping and storage to DIY furniture and garden tasks. Their adaptability contributes to their appeal.
Support Local Businesses: Buying second-hand pallets can frequently mean acquiring from local sources, adding to the regional economy and lowering carbon footprints related to transport.
Secret Considerations When Buying Second Hand Wooden Pallets
Before buying pre-owned wooden pallets, it's important to think about numerous factors to guarantee optimum use:
Condition: Inspect the pallets for damage. Look for fractures, damaged boards, protruding nails, or signs of rot. Excellent quality pallets are essential, especially if they will be used for transferring products.
Pallet Markings: Familiarize yourself with various marking systems, such as the IPPC stamp, which indicates the pallet has been treated for pests and is safe for worldwide shipping. Avoid unmarked or questionable pallets.
Size and Weight: Ensure the size and capability of the pallets fulfill your requirements. Consider your storage space and weight limitations.
Cleaning and Treatment: Second-hand pallets need to be cleaned up and dealt with to eliminate impurities. Research how to effectively tidy and prepare your pallets before usage, particularly if they will be Used Wooden Pallets in food storage.
Local Regulations: Different regions have guidelines relating to pallet use, especially when it comes to shipping agricultural products. Guarantee compliance with regional laws.

Q: How long do wooden pallets last?A: The life-span of a wooden pallet can vary extensively depending on its usage and care. Usually, a properly maintained pallet can last for numerous years.
